当前位置: 首页>>代码示例 >>用法及示例精选 >>正文


Processing saveJSONObject()用法及代码示例


Processing, saveJSONObject()用法介绍。

用法

  • saveJSONObject(json, filename)
  • saveJSONObject(json, filename, options)

参数

  • json (JSONObject) 要保存的 JSONObject
  • filename (String) 要保存到的文件的名称
  • options (String) "compact"和"indent=N",将N替换为空格数

返回

  • boolean

说明

JSONObject 对象的内容写入文件。默认情况下,此文件保存到草图的文件夹中。通过从"Sketch" 菜单中选择“显示草图文件夹”打开此文件夹。



或者,可以使用绝对路径(在 Unix 和 Linux 上以 /开头,或在 Windows 上以驱动器号开头)将文件保存到计算机上的任何位置。



Processing API 加载和保存的所有文件都使用 UTF-8 编码。

例子

JSONObject json;

void setup() {

  json = new JSONObject();

  json.setInt("id", 0);
  json.setString("species", "Panthera leo");
  json.setString("name", "Lion");

  saveJSONObject(json, "data/new.json");
}

// Sketch saves the following to a file called "new.json":
// {
//   "id": 0,
//   "species": "Panthera leo",
//   "name": "Lion"
// }

相关用法


注:本文由纯净天空筛选整理自processing.org大神的英文原创作品 saveJSONObject()。非经特殊声明,原始代码版权归原作者所有,本译文未经允许或授权,请勿转载或复制。